Philadelphia Eagles 2026 NFL Draft Strategy: Edge Rusher, Safety, Offense & QB Depth

The Philadelphia Eagles, fresh off a successful free agency period, turn their attention to the 2026 NFL Draft. With a focus on defense and offense, they aim to build for the long term. The draft simulator suggests they start with Auburn edge rusher Keldric Faulk at pick 23, followed by LSU safety AJ Haulcy in round 2. Later rounds see the addition of North Dakota wideout Bryce Lance, Iowa center Logan Jones, and a developmental quarterback in LSUs Garrett Nussmeier. The mock draft concludes with tight end Justin Joly, Penn State runner Nicholas Singleton, and corner Thaddeus Dixon, aiming to strengthen the roster around stars like Saquon Barkley and Jalen Hurts.
